Victor Moses close to return from injury

Victor Moses return to the field of play is not farfetched as the footballers recent back-to-back heavy trainings is a pointer to the fact.

Days after training inside a swimming pool, the Chelsea player employed the services of an anti-gravity treadmill to train even harder. Moses took to his Instagram page to share a video of himself working out earnestly on the treading mill. “Another day of hard work getting there slowly 🙏🏿 thanks for all of your messages of support #CFC,” Moses wrote.

The Super Eagles star looks forward to bouncing back to the beautiful game after few weeks of being out due to a hamstring injury he incurred against Crystal Palace.
